Six years after the pandemic shut the world down, the mental health crisis it triggered hasn't gone away—it's just quieter. Dr. Christopher S. Taylor, founder and CEO of Taylor Counseling Group and an existential psychotherapist with a doctorate in counseling, joins Jeff Crilley to talk about what he's seeing in his practice and why he believes we're still in a "loneliness pandemic."Dr. Taylor shares how his practice nearly folded during lockdown before telehealth saved it, and how Taylor Counseling Group has since expanded to over 55 therapists and 10 locations across Texas. He explains his values-based therapy approach—the idea that small daily choices that conflict with your core values quietly compound until you're asking "who am I?"—and tells the story of a client named Brooke whose total transformation after divorce left him unable to recognize her when she walked back into his office years later.The conversation gets into the quarter-life crisis hitting people in their twenties, the pressure on 12-year-olds to plan careers decades out, and the link between Instagram's 2009 smartphone launch and the first meaningful tracking of preteen suicide. Dr. Taylor also previews his upcoming book, "You Are Here," built around real client stories of self-discovery.https://taylorcounselinggroup.com
